Transaction 9020dc11491e23757e1cf16fa3c0d7dc2630ac5739662dff6abfbec4513131d9
2 Input
1 Outputs
- 9020dc11491e23757e1cf16fa3c0d7dc2630ac5739662dff6abfbec4513131d9:0
value 1048945
address 3LgDPFEgUmf89hULPmmQFmvFgixiVUAhmi